ky4062, I only see you pointing to one vacuum line on the Y-manifold. That one connection actually goes to another spot on the same piece of aluminum before it connects to the curved upper intake that comes from the side of the engine. It looks to me like you are pointing to the hose with the cap-off nipple on it (which is not a factory setup). If you are pointing to the hose that is just to the side of the three color-coded hose connections on top of the throttle body that's different.

I'll shoot you a couple of pictures.

For hose, go to a local auto parts supply store (not Autozone or Pepboys... they won't have it) or go online and pick up some Gates #27042 hose. Should be 5/32nds inner-diameter like the OEM vacuum hoses. Or you can bring the section of old hose to a Toyota parts counter and they can match it for you at whatever length you want.
